DIY Intercooler piping shape compromise - Long and smooth or short and kinked?
I'm putting a saab vigen IC in my 93 hatch. My compressor outlet is positioned in such a way that the 2" warm side piping will have to be about 1.5 feet long and coiled up and kinked like a snake OR it could be 3 feet and have very nice smooth bends.
What is the "best' setup or what are the tradeoffs that i may not have thought of?
i know more internal pipe volume the worse the boost response. Will sharp bends right out of the compressor really matter since the air is so turbulant? thanks for any ideas
